Prep and Cook Time
- Preparation: 20 minutes
- Cook Time: 1 hour 20 minutes
- Total Time: 1 hour 40 minutes
Yield
Serves 4 to 6 people
Difficulty Level
Medium - Perfect for home cooks ready to elevate their roasting skills
Ingredients
- 1 whole chicken (about 4 to 4.5 lbs), patted dry
- 2 tbsp olive oil, plus extra for drizzling
- 1 tbsp sea salt, preferably flaky
- 1 tsp freshly ground black pepper
- 1 tbsp smoked paprika
- 4 garlic cloves, smashed
- 1 lemon, halved
- 4 sprigs fresh thyme
- 3 large carrots, peeled and cut into thick batons
- 2 medium parsnips, peeled and cut into batons
- 1 large red bell pepper, cut into strips
- 1 small red onion, quartered
- 1 tbsp balsamic vinegar
- Fresh parsley, chopped for garnish
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C). Position a rack in the center of the oven.
- Prepare the chicken: Ensure your chicken skin is completely dry - this step is vital for crispiness. Pat down with paper towels, then gently loosen the skin around the breasts and thighs with your fingers.
- Season under the skin: Mix olive oil, salt, pepper, and smoked paprika. Rub this seasoning generously under the skin and all over the outside of the bird. Insert smashed garlic cloves, lemon halves, and thyme sprigs into the cavity for aromatic infusion.
- Arrange the vegetables: In a large roasting pan, toss carrots, parsnips, bell pepper, and onion with a drizzle of olive oil, a pinch of salt, and the balsamic vinegar.Spread them evenly to create a colorful,roasting bed for your chicken.
- Place the chicken on top of the vegetables breast-side up.Tuck the wing tips under the body for even cooking and a tidy presentation.
- Roast uncovered for 1 hour to 1 hour 20 minutes, basting the chicken with pan juices halfway through. The skin will transform into a lovely golden crust – resist the urge to cover it,which softens crispiness.
- Check doneness by inserting a meat thermometer into the thickest thigh; it should read 165°F (74°C). Let the chicken rest for 15 minutes before carving to retain juicy flavors.
Perfecting the Golden Roast Chicken Skin with Vibrant,flavor-Packed Vegetables
Achieving the coveted crispy skin begins with one crucial rule: dryness is king. Moisture is the enemy of crunch-pat your chicken dry and let it air-dry in the fridge uncovered for a few hours if possible. The olive oil and smoked paprika mixture not only protects the skin from drying out but also adds an earthy warmth to its golden hue. Low-and-slow roasting at a high temperature allows the fat beneath the skin to render, crisping it to perfection while keeping the breast meat tender and juicy. Roasting the vegetables underneath infuses them with the rich chicken drippings, elevating their flavor and ensuring every bite is deliciously complex.

chef’s Notes & Tips for Success
- Patience with drying: For best skin crispness, dry the chicken uncovered in the fridge overnight if possible.
- Vegetable variations: Sweet potatoes, Brussels sprouts, or cherry tomatoes also roast beautifully alongside your chicken.
- resting is essential: Don’t slice too soon; this keeps juices locked inside the meat.
- Make-ahead: Prep the chicken and vegetables the day before,keep covered in the fridge,and roast just before dinner.
- Extra crunch: For lightning-fast addition, give the skin a final blast under the broiler for 2-3 minutes, watching carefully.

Q&A: Golden Roast Chicken with Vibrant, Flavor-Packed Vegetables
Q1: What makes the chicken in this recipe achieve that perfect golden roast color?
A1: The secret to that irresistible golden hue lies in a combination of a high-heat roast and a well-balanced seasoning rub. A light coating of olive oil or melted butter, alongside aromatic herbs like thyme and rosemary, helps the skin crisp and brown evenly.Additionally, a sprinkle of paprika adds a subtle warmth and enhances the golden appearance.
Q2: How do you ensure the vegetables stay vibrant and full of flavor during roasting?
A2: To keep vegetables vibrant and flavorful, it’s crucial to toss them in a mix of olive oil, garlic, and fresh herbs before roasting at a high enough temperature to caramelize their natural sugars without overcooking. Adding a splash of lemon juice or zest after roasting brightens the dish with a fresh contrast to the rich roasted flavors.
Q3: Which vegetables complement golden roast chicken best for a harmonious plate?
A3: Root vegetables like carrots, parsnips, and sweet potatoes provide natural sweetness that balances the savory chicken. Colorful bell peppers, zucchini, and cherry tomatoes bring brightness and texture, while red onions add a gentle, sweet bite once roasted. Together, they create a vibrant mosaic both in flavor and appearance.
Q4: Can this dish be adapted for a fast weeknight dinner?
A4: Absolutely! Opt for chicken thighs or drumsticks,which cook faster than a whole bird,and use pre-cut vegetables to save prep time. While it won’t have quite the same wow factor as a whole roast, the flavors still shine through in a simplified, speedy version.
Q5: What herbs and spices are essential in enhancing the flavor profile of this dish?
A5: Classic Mediterranean herbs-thyme, rosemary, and oregano-infuse the chicken and vegetables with woodsy aromatics. Ground black pepper, garlic powder, and a pinch of smoked paprika bring depth and a subtle smoky warmth. fresh parsley or basil added at the end lifts the dish with a pop of herbaceous freshness.
Q6: How do you keep the chicken juicy while achieving crispy skin?
A6: Patting the chicken skin dry before seasoning is key to crispiness.Roasting at a high temperature initially helps render the fat beneath the skin, creating crunch. To lock in moisture, let the chicken rest after roasting; the juices redistribute, yielding tender, succulent meat beneath that crispy shell.
Q7: What’s a creative way to serve this dish for a special gathering?
A7: Serve the golden roast chicken on a wooden board surrounded by the colorful roasted vegetables, garnished with edible flowers or fresh herbs for an eye-catching centerpiece. Pair with a side of herbed couscous or a vibrant green salad to create a festive, well-rounded feast.
Q8: Are there any tips for seasoning the vegetables to complement the chicken without overpowering it?
A8: Keep vegetable seasoning simple and fresh. A drizzle of good-quality olive oil, salt, pepper, and a couple of sprigs of herbs is enough. Let the natural sweetness and earthiness of the veggies shine through, while the chicken provides richness and savory depth.Adding a hint of acidity-like lemon zest-at the end keeps everything balanced.
Q9: Can this recipe be made ahead or saved as leftovers?
A9: Yes! Roast the chicken and vegetables completely, then cool before storing in airtight containers. Reheat gently in the oven to restore crispy skin and fresh flavors. Leftovers also make excellent filling for wraps or tossed into salads for next-day meals.Q10: How crucial is the roasting pan choice when preparing this dish?
A10: A shallow roasting pan or rimmed baking sheet with good heat conduction ensures even cooking and caramelization. Using a pan with a rack lifts the chicken off the vegetables slightly, helping the skin crisp better and allowing the veggies to roast in the flavorful drippings without becoming soggy.
